Three women representing the Collierstown United Methodist Women in Faith attended the annual district meeting held at St. Mark’s United Methodist Church in Daleville on Saturday, Oct. 14. They were Carolyn Manspile, Linda Painter and Delores Rhodenizer. At the meeting each unit’s accomplishments were recognized and memorial tributes were given in memory of deceased members. Nancy P. Clark, an active and dedicated member of the Collierstown United Methodist Women in Faith, was among those honored.

The Collierstown United Methodist Church will host a spaghetti supper at the church on Saturday evening, Oct. 21, beginning at 5 p.m. The meal includes allyou- can-eat spaghetti, tossed salad, bread, dessert and assorted beverages. The cost of the meal is by donation.

Leading the 11 a.m. worship service at the Collierstown Presbyterian Church on Sunday, O ct. 15, w as G reg Jewitt. T he Collierstown Presbyterian Church will hold a cleanup day of the buildings and grounds on Saturday, Oct. 21, beginning at 8:30 a.m. in preparation for its annual church dinner that will be held on Saturday, Nov. 4.

The Effinger Ruritan Club will meet tomorrow, Thursday, Oct. 19, at 6 p.m. at the Palmer Community Center. The evening’s meal will be served by the Collierstown Presbyterian Church’s Night Circle.

A “trunk or treat” event sponsored by the Effinger community churches will be held on Saturday, Oct. 21, from 3 to 5 p.m. in the field across from the Effinger Volunteer Fire Department. Church members will be in decorated cars handing out candy treats to the community’s children. This year’s “trunk or treat” will also offer a cakewalk activity. Funds raised from the sale of cakewalk tickets will be divided and donated to the community’s Rise Against Hunger meal packing day to be held in the spring and to the Challenger Baseball League for disabled children in Roanoke. Participating churches for this year’s “trunk or treat” include the Collierstown Baptist, Collierstown Presbyterian, Collierstown United Methodist, Mt. Horeb United Methodist, Oxford Presbyterian, Rapps Church, and the Union View Advent Christian Church.
